This Conserver Dishwasher, with its Door Type design, measures 30-3/8"W x 29-1/2"D x 68-1/2"H. It uses low temperature chemical sanitizing and features a built-in booster heater to ensure a 145° rinse water. With three selectable timed cycles, this dishwasher can handle approximately 39 racks per hour. It also includes an electronic timer, 3 built-in dispensing pumps, and a scrap accumulator. The removable scrap screen and auto-start function make it convenient to use. It is constructed with stainless steel and comes with adjustable bullet feet. Daily Cleaning: Clean filters, spray arms, and the interior regularly to ensure efficient cleaning and sanitizing.
Monitor Water Temperature: Ensure the built-in booster heater maintains a 145° rinse temperature for proper sanitization.
Check Chemical Sanitizer Levels: Ensure the correct level of chemical sanitizer is being dispensed for effective cleaning.
Descale Periodically: Use a commercial descaler to prevent mineral build-up, especially in areas with hard water.
Inspect Door Seals: Check door seals regularly to maintain proper sealing for efficient performance.
Service Annually: Schedule professional maintenance to inspect and keep the dishwasher running at peak efficiency.
